摘要
传统光谱分析手段在航空发动机磨损类故障定位方面局限性突显。综合应用光谱监控分析、铁谱监控分析、自动磨粒监控三种技术在航空发动机的磨损类故障检测中具有互补准确的优点。针对国产新型发动机的综合监控方法和数据库软件的应用能大大提高航空发动机滑油监控的安全性。
The traditional spectral analysis method have limit highlight in aeroengine wear fault location.Analysis on comprehensive application of spectrum monitoring, ferrography monitoring analysis and automatic grinding monitoring, these three kinds of technology have complementary accurate merits in the wear fault detection of aeroengine.For the application of domestic new engine integrated monitoring method and database software can greatly increase the safty monitoring of aeroengine lubricating oil.
